CPMCCalifornia Pacific Med Center Van NessPosition Overview:
Assists in maintaining and continually improving the laboratorys Quality Management Program (QMP) to include monitoring reporting and assessing performancerelated information. Functions as a subject matter expert; advises on all aspects of the Labs Quality Control Program Process Management and External/Internal Assessments (i.e. proficiency testing and surveys/inspections). Investigates reports and facilitates resolution of nonconforming events. Provides data and reports to support the quality review activities of the Medical and Operations Management teams ensuring continual improvement of operational quality and service. Facilitates the design and validation of efficient workflow processes. Conducts and participates in qualityrelated meetings. Develops a variety of QMP documents (process maps/tables procedures and forms) Supports regulatory compliance and accreditation readiness by coordinating or completing activities to fulfill requirements. Promotes a culture of quality by educating others. Facilitates complete and compliant management of records as applicable to assigned Lab section(s)Job Description:

EDUCATION:
Other: Graduate of an accredited Clinical Laboratory Scientist program
CERTIFICATION & LICENSURE:
CLSLLicensed Clinical Lab Scientist
TYPICAL EXPERIENCE:
5 years recent relevant experience
SKILLS AND KNOWLEDGE:
Demonstrated knowledge and technical competence in quality systems project management and regulatory compliance.
Knowledge of 1988 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A 88) federal certification requirements and standards and State Federal Accrediting Agency.
Knowledge of California Business and Professional Codes (BPC) Chapter 3 Title 17; Chapter 2 of California Code of Regulations (CCR) Codes of Federal Regulation (CFR) and any other governing the practice of laboratory medicine.
Knowledge of quality practices and procedures within a clinical laboratory environment including knowledge of Chemistry Hematology Point of Care Microbiology and Transfusion Medicine.
Welldeveloped analytic and software skill. Working knowledge of Lab Information system (LIS) and hospital electronic medical record systems.
